Google’s Pixel smartphones are popular among serious Android fans, but unfortunately, they are not officially available in South Africa. Google does not roll out its Pixel smartphones worldwide, and while you can import the devices, it is usually easier – and safer – to consider local alternatives.

One of the biggest advantages of the Pixel lineup is that it is always first with Android updates and runs a clean operating system free of the Android skins major manufacturers put in their phones.

The specifications of the devices – notably the Pixel 2 – also make them attractive to heavy smartphone users.

South Africans looking for a Pixel-like experience do have other options, however, thanks to Nokia’s latest flagship device.

Of course this phone may not have the identical camera hardware to the Pixel 2 and I'm wondering how clean the Android OS is. It may sound expensive at R13,000 but a Pixel 2 needs shipping, VAT and duty added to it (along with a few challenges if anything is faulty down the line).
